[snip] There may be additional things like semi-dwarf plums, vine
maples, particularly hardy Japanese maple cultivars, for which zone 5
is the low-end stretch, but as you're planting near the house they
would be quite protected & have some risidual warmth from the house.
-paghat the ratgirl
If you like Japanese maples but live too far north for them, look at the
Korean maples; they are basicly the same thing but are more cold hardy.
